FONDUE BROTH



Fondue Broth image

Denis and I have had the most wonderful evenings with friends over our fondue pot. Lots of wine and great conversations. Some evenings lasting 4 or 5 hours. Hope you will all try this recipe and enjoy it as much as we do!

Provided by Midge Plourde

Categories     Meat

Time 1h5m

Yield 1 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 bay leaves
2 garlic cloves, minced (I use 4-5)
2 teaspoons dried parsley
2 teaspoons fresh ground pepper
2 (10 1/2 ounce) cans nonfat beef broth (I use Campbell's sodium reduced- fat-free broth)
0.5 (750 ml) bottle dry white wine or 1 cup water
2 cups water
1 (1 ounce) package French onion soup mix
0.5 (8 ounce) bottle of heinz seafood sauce

Steps:

  • Mix all the ingredients in your fondue pot, and simmer for 1 hour.
  • When you are ready to start, bring the broth to a boil.
  • We usually have thinnly sliced beef (Chinese fondue beef), large raw tiger shrimp, scallops, portabello mushrooms, and chicken.
  • Of course, you can have what ever meat and vegetables you wish.
  • Guten apetit!

THE MELTING POT MOJO FONDUE BROTH



The Melting Pot Mojo Fondue Broth image

From Dave Ahem, co-owner of The Melting Pot in downtown Minneapolis. Source: Midwest Home Magazine, Sept. 2007 Savvy Host Recipes.

Provided by chrystal_wineinger

Categories     Vegetable

Time 20m

Yield 1 pot, 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

5 1/4 cups vegetable bouillon or 5 1/4 cups chicken bouillon
1/4 cup orange juice, fresh-squeezed
1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
2 tablespoons ground cumin
2 tablespoons jerk seasoning
2 tablespoons black pepper, cracked
2 tablespoons lime juice, fresh-squeezed
1 tablespoon minced garlic

Steps:

  • Combine ingredients in saucepan on stovetop.
  • Bring to a boil.
  • Transfer to fondue pot with alternative heat source.
  • Use to cook beef, shrimp, potstickers, chicken, mushrooms, potatoes, broccoli -- or anything else you can think of.
  • Veggies are wonderful with "Green Goddess Dip" recipe # 346525.
